
Introduction Throughout the SARS-CoV-2 pandemic, there have been reports of infection leading to acute myocardial injury, causing worse clinical outcomes. The manifestations can include troponin elevation, imaging exam abnormalities and electrocardiographic changes. Accordingly, ST-segment elevation (STE) acute myocardial injury has been observed in some patients. However, despite the electrocardiogram (ECG) ischemic changes, complementary exams may not show any obstruction, excluding coronary occlusion as the cause of the injury.
